    Ingredients

    The ingredients needed to make Masoor Dahl (Red Lentil Curry) with Rice:

    1. Get 1 cups lentils (red kind)
    2. Make ready 4 cups water
    3. Get 2 onion
    4. Prepare 2 tomato
    5. Take to taste Ginger root
    6. Take cloves Garlic to taste
    7. Make ready Ground cumin
    8. Take Ground garam masala
    9. Prepare Ground coriander
    10. Make ready Ground cardamom
    11. Make ready Chili powder
    12. Make ready Cayenne pepper
    13. Make ready Ground turmeric
    14. Prepare Salt
    15. Make ready Ghee or oil
    16. Prepare Fresh Coriander
    17. Make ready Ground cinnamon
    18. Get 1 cup rice

    Instructions

    Instructions to make Masoor Dahl (Red Lentil Curry) with Rice:

    1. Wash and rinse the rice. Then cook your rice per package directions and set aside. While rice is cooking wash and rinse your lentils then set aside
    2. Dice onion garlic ginger tomato and set aside
    3. In a bowl, proportion your spices to taste and set aside. I usually lead with turmeric and cumin as 11/2tsp ea followed by the rest at 1/4 to 1/2 tsp ea. You could just use a curry powder if you want. Proportion to taste. I used a curry powder (big pile on white cutting board) in the below photo along with some other spices. I did use a measuring spoon because it makes cool little piles)
    4. Heat ghee or oil in a pot then saute the onion until brown over medium high heat
    5. Add garlic and ginger to pot then saute for another 1 minutes or so
    6. Add diced tomato and saute for another 2 minutes or so
    7. Add spices and mix into the masala and let them cook for 1 minute or so
    8. Add lentils and mix until coated in spices
    9. Add water, start with 2 cups in and then bring to boil then turn heat down and simmer covered for 20 to 30 minutes. Make sure to check it and give it a stir every so often. Add additional water as needed to form your desired consistency. (Blury photo)
    10. Chop the coriander then add to the pot. Reserve some leaves to add to each serving. Below photo was taken before I added some coriander to my bowl
    11. You can do the same thing with chickpeas (channa dahl) just follow direction for preparing/cooking dried chickpeas or use canned version. I prefer the dried pulses.
    12. You can also omit the pulse and just add chicken and potato to make a chicken curry dish. I guess that is another receipe…lol
